Read on to learn how to repair mortar joints. tes skolastik guru penggerakWebJun 27, 2024 · Use a brick trowel and a tuck pointer to pack the mortar into the joints. Most pros prefer this method to using a grout/mortar bag. Mortar that is hand packed is more durable. Scoop mortar onto the trowel. Hold the trowel next to the joint, then press the mortar into the joint with the tuck pointer ( Photo 7 ). tessmer sanierung gmbhWebSteps for repointing a stone foundation Fill a plant mister with water and spray the mortar to keep down the dust. Mass walls are load bearing and … teßmann spandauWebNov 15, 2024 · The cost also depends on the number of walls that need to be completed. Here are a few examples: Repointing a single wall – such as at the front or side of a house – costs £1,500 – £2,200. Repointing a semi-detached modern house costs around £4,000 – £5,000. Repointing a Victorian terraced property costs around £3,000 – £4,400. tes smart gma verbal dan jawabannyaWebChiseling is tedious, painstaking and, for cement-covered joints, frustratingly slow.
